The Guppy Open Submission Competition for YA writers is now open!

The portholes of Guppy Books are open to all unagented and unpublished YA writers who have a novel to share!

Please email your submission to submissions@guppybooks.co.uk between 9am Monday 6th June and 6pm Friday 10th June 2022 (GMT).

Please include the first 2000 words of your young adult novel, plus a synopsis, preferably as a Word attachment. Entry is free, although we would ask you to support Guppy Books as an independent publisher by buying a Guppy book from any bookshop or online store.

We will be announcing a longlist in early July, a shortlist in late July, and a winner will be offered a contract with Guppy Books in the autumn. Please keep an eye out on social media and our website for confirmation of future dates.
